Which is a true conclusion based on the Venn diagram? If a number is prime, it is also odd. If a number is odd, it is also prime
krek1111 [17]

Answer:

If a number is prime, it may or may not be odd.

Step-by-step explanation:

The prime numbers are all natural numbers greater than 1, which are only divisible between themselves and between 1. For example: 2, 3, 5, 7, 11 ...

A Venn diagram is shown in the attached figure

There you can see that not all even numbers are primes for example, 4 is an even number, but it is not a prime number. Then, not all odd numbers are prime numbers, for example 9 is an odd number, but it is not a prime number.

Neither all prime numbers are odd, for example the number 2 is a prime number and it is not odd.

Notice in the attached Venn diagram that the set of prime numbers contains even numbers and also odd numbers.

Therefore, the correct statement is the last option:

If a number is prime, it may or may not be odd.
